How much does a crawl space vapor barrier cost?
A vapor barrier project can be a relatively simple ground-cover installation or part of a much larger moisture-control system. That difference is why two bids can look very different even when both use the phrase “vapor barrier.”
What changes the scope
- Square footage: more exposed ground and wall area means more material and labor.
- Material thickness: heavier reinforced liners generally cost more than basic polyethylene.
- Sealing details: taped seams, piers, posts and wall transitions add labor.
- Access: low clearance, tight entries, ducts and plumbing can slow installation.
- Cleanup: debris, wet insulation or old plastic may need removal before new material goes down.
Vapor barrier versus encapsulation
A basic ground barrier mainly reduces moisture coming from exposed soil. Encapsulation usually goes further by lining walls, sealing vents and penetrations and sometimes adding dehumidification. If a contractor is proposing the larger system, compare our crawl space encapsulation cost guide.
Do not ignore standing water
A liner does not replace drainage. If water collects under the house, ask where it comes from and how it will be removed. Our crawl space moisture repair cost guide helps separate drainage, sump, dehumidification and structural scopes.
Questions to ask before approving the bid
- What material thickness and reinforcement are included?
- Will the liner cover only the ground or also the walls?
- How are seams, posts and penetrations sealed?
- Is old material and debris removal included?
- Is drainage or dehumidification being proposed separately?
Structural damage is a different project
If moisture has already damaged joists, beams, sill plates or supports, ask for that repair to be priced separately. A vapor barrier can help manage moisture but does not restore damaged structural wood.
